This tool helps California employers and employees determine the correct penalty amounts for missed meal and rest breaks. It typically involves inputting information such as the employee’s regular rate of pay, the number of missed breaks, and the dates of the violations. An accurate calculation ensures compliance with California labor laws regarding meal and rest periods.

Accurate and accessible calculation of these penalties is crucial for maintaining positive employee relations, avoiding potential legal disputes, and fostering a culture of compliance. Understanding these regulations dates back to the Industrial Welfare Commission’s establishment of basic labor standards, which have evolved over time to protect employee well-being and ensure fair compensation. Proper use of such a tool safeguards businesses from costly penalties and fosters a fair working environment.

Supplemental income, such as bonuses, received by California residents is subject to both federal and state income taxes. While employers often withhold taxes from bonuses, the default withholding rate may not accurately reflect an individual’s overall tax liability. Online tools can help estimate the net amount received after taxes are deducted, considering factors like the bonus amount, regular income, filing status, and withholding allowances. For example, a single filer receiving a $5,000 bonus might find that significantly less than $5,000 is deposited in their account due to withholding.

Accurately estimating tax liability on bonus income is crucial for financial planning and avoiding potential underpayment penalties. Historically, discrepancies between withheld taxes and actual tax liability have been a source of confusion for taxpayers. Resources for calculating this liability provide valuable insight and promote informed financial decision-making. Understanding the interplay between federal and California state tax regulations is essential for residents receiving bonuses.

A tool designed to estimate spousal support payments in California divorces considers factors such as length of the marriage, each spouse’s income and earning capacity, separate property, and community property debts. For example, a ten-year marriage with disparate incomes might yield different support calculations than a shorter-term marriage where both parties have similar earning potential. These tools offer preliminary estimates and should not be considered legal advice.

Predicting potential support obligations provides individuals navigating the complexities of divorce with a clearer financial picture. This can be instrumental in facilitating settlements and reducing the emotional and financial strain of protracted legal proceedings. While these tools have become increasingly accessible with advancements in technology, the underlying principles of California family law regarding spousal support have remained consistent, emphasizing fairness and the ability of both parties to transition to independent financial lives after divorce.
